Vignetting is a photographic term that refers to the darkening of image corners that occurs due to the lens's inability to distribute light evenly. Interestingly, many words can be used to describe this phenomenon, including shading, veiling, darkening, falloff, and obscurance. Each of these terms encompasses the same basic concept as vignetting, which is a reduction in brightness or contrast at the edges of a photo. While vignetting is commonly seen as an artistic effect, it can also indicate a lens or camera defect.
